Police Officer 2
Job Summary
This position is reserved for police officer positions who have already obtained their Georgia Police Officers Standards and Training (P.O.S.T.) Basic Mandate course and are either transferring from Police Officer I after completing the AUPD Field Training Officer program or have already been employed by another law enforcement agency.
Responsibilities
The duties include, but are not limited to:
- Prepare required documents and reports.
- Effect arrests and restrain persons consistent with the tenants of probable cause and reasonable suspicion.
- Conduct investigations, collect and identify evidence, question principals and witnesses, testify in court.
- Conduct safety escorts.
- Assist police dispatcher as necessary.
- Patrol a designated area of the University projecting a community-oriented policing mindset, preserve law and order, be alert for and control commission of crimes, answer calls to include, but not limited to trespassing, thefts, fire and burglar alarms, traffic accidents, and enforce traffic regulations.
- Perform all other related duties as assigned.
